Grant and Funding Programs Offered by MRC Deux-Montagnes

Overview of Available Grants and Funding

The Deux-Montagnes Regional County Municipality (RCM) is a key player in regional economic development, coordinating initiatives across its territory and providing support to local businesses. As a designated administrator of government grant programs, it manages various funds and financial assistance programs aimed at stimulating investment and economic growth. True to its mission of supporting entrepreneurs, the RCM supports business projects at every stage by offering advice, mentorship, and financing options. Through its coordinating role across the territory, it works to harmonize the development efforts of its seven member municipalities, thus contributing to a dynamic and sustainable local economy.
